Access Denied

You don't have permission to access "http://info.taiwantrade.com/biznews/%E5%AD%9F%E5%9C%8B%E5%B0%87%E8%A8%AD%E7%AB%8B%E5%A4%AA%E9%99%BD%E8%83%BD%E8%B7%AF%E7%87%88-922138.html" on this server.

Reference #18.4ed73017.1711698839.37f04c0

https://errors.edgesuite.net/18.4ed73017.1711698839.37f04c0